The House is scheduled to vote on H.R. 4296, a bill to place requirements on operational risk capital requirements for banking organizations established by an appropriate Federal banking agency as well as H.R  1865, the Allow States and Victims to Fight Online Sex Trafficking Act of 2017.  On the other side of the Capitol, the Senate plans to consider several federal court nominations.

In addition, the House may consider H.R. 4296, a bill to place requirements on operational risk capital requirements for banking organizations established by an appropriate Federal banking agency.  This bill specifies that a federal banking agency may not establish an operational-risk capital requirement for banking organizations unless the requirement: (1) is based on, and is appropriately sensitive to, current risks; (2) is determined under a forward-looking assessment of potential losses; and (3) allows certain adjustments.

Also, on the House suspension calendar, is the TRID Improvement Act of 2018.
